Research centres
Our strategic research institutes undertake large-scale, world-class research to address some of the world’s most complex issues, from fighting the war on waste to protecting our marine environment.
Centre for Cyber Resilience and Trust
The Centre for Cyber Resilience and Trust is empowering people, organisations and communities to thrive in a digital society.
Centre for Regional and Rural Futures
The Centre for Regional and Rural Futures contributes to the design of smarter technologies that provide innovative solutions to regional and rural productivity problems.
Centre for Sustainable Bioproducts
The Centre for Sustainable Bioproducts develops new approaches to convert organic waste (biomass) into sustainable, high-value bioproducts, providing industry partners with the opportunity to test and innovate new processing techniques at a pilot manufacturing scale.
Deakin HOME
Deakin HOME brings together communities, not-for-profit organisations, industry and government to solve complex problems around affordable housing, homelessness and social inclusion.
Deakin Marine Research and Innovation Centre
Deakin Marine Research and Innovation Centre – Deakin Marine – is Victoria’s leading university-based marine centre. Our unrivalled research breadth and expertise drives transformational outcomes for ocean-based economies and the environment.
